Primary Spoils Dam
Key Takeaway
Primary Spoils Dam is classified as high hazard in Missouri. It was completed in 1988 and is 38 years old. High hazard means loss of life is likely if the dam fails — it does not indicate the dam's current condition. Learn more.
Physical Details
| Dam Height | 50 ft (taller than 95% in MO) |
| Dam Length | 250 ft |
| Dam Type | Earth |
| Max Storage | 720 acre-ft |
| Normal Storage | 600 acre-ft |
| Surface Area | 36 acres |
| Drainage Area | 0 sq mi |
| Max Discharge | 80 cfs |
| Year Completed | 1988 (38 years old) |
| Year Modified | 1996 |
| NID ID | MO32037 |
